dalton deposited $7,000 in an account earning 10% interest compounded annually. to the nearest cent, how much interest will he earn in 4 years? use the formula $b = p(1 + r)^t$, where $b$ is the balance (final amount), $p$ is the principal (starting amount), $r$ is the interest rate expressed as a decimal, and $t$ is the time in years.

Answer

Explanation:

Step1: Identify the values

$p = 7000$, $r=0.1$, $t = 4$

Step2: Calculate the final amount $B$

$B=p(1 + r)^t=7000\times(1 + 0.1)^4=7000\times1.1^4=7000\times1.4641 = 10248.7$

Step3: Calculate the interest

Interest $=B - p=10248.7-7000 = 3248.7$

Answer:

$3248.70$
